About One component, two interactions. Move across it — as a cursor, or with a drag. The surface leans away from your hand, lags a beat behind, then eases back to flat once you stop. Image Warp is a WebGL ripple effect built for exactly those two moments: pointing and dragging. The same physics works whether the image is following your pointer or living inside a carousel. Use Cases A navigation list where the cursor becomes the preview — hover a name and the subject's photo materializes at the pointer, distorting with each movement. The image doesn't sit on the page. It follows you across it. A director or artist roster where the work finds the pointer — no thumbnail grid, no hover card. Just names, and an image that bends into view at the cursor the moment one is moused over. The whole page breathes without a single static preview. Product galleries and case-study carousels, on drag — the image resists a little as you pull it, the same way flipping a physical print would, instead of sliding past on rails. Anywhere a site owner has said "I want it to feel alive when someone touches it" — a portrait grid, a lookbook, a single hero image. Fits photography portfolios, agencies, and product pages — anywhere the picture is the pitch. Properties Setup Usage: Custom Cursor or Slideshow Slide Image Fit: Cover or Contain Motion Strength: how much the image ripples Recovery: 0 = fluid, 1 = snappy — how fast it settles back to flat Overflow: how far the ripple can push past the frame edge Slideshow only Group: slides sharing the same Group ripple together on drag — give a second Slideshow a different Group so it doesn't react to the first one Reset on Release: Snap or Fade (what happens the moment you let go of the drag) Platform Enable on Touch: runs the WebGL effect on touch devices when on; shows a plain image with no ripple when off
